Common Reasons for Fox61 News App Issues
Alright, let's talk about the elephant in the room: why is the Fox61 News app giving you the cold shoulder? There are a few culprits that often cause streaming apps, including the Fox61 News one, to act up on your Roku. The most frequent reason is often related to a simple internet connection hiccup. Roku devices, like any streaming gadget, rely heavily on a stable and speedy internet connection to download and display content. If your Wi-Fi is playing games, acting slow, or has temporarily dropped, the app simply can't fetch the news you want to see. It’s like trying to have a conversation with someone on a bad phone line – choppy and frustrating.
Another biggie is that the Fox61 News app itself might be the issue. Apps need updates just like your phone or computer. If the app is outdated, it might not be compatible with the latest Roku software, or it could have bugs that are preventing it from loading properly. Developers push out updates to fix these little glitches and improve performance, so keeping the app updated is pretty darn crucial. Think of it like giving your app a fresh coat of paint and a tune-up.
Then there's the Roku device itself. Sometimes, your Roku box or stick can get a little bogged down with temporary data, kind of like a computer that hasn't been restarted in a while. This cached data can sometimes interfere with app performance. A simple restart of your Roku device can often clear out this digital clutter and get things running smoothly again. It’s a classic IT solution for a reason – it works!
And let's not forget about the Fox61 News servers. While less common, it's possible that the problem isn't on your end at all. The news provider might be experiencing technical difficulties with their streaming service, leading to app outages. In these cases, all you can really do is wait for them to sort it out. Step 1: Check Your Internet Connection
Okay, first things first, let's address the most likely culprit: your internet connection. Seriously, guys, this is the number one reason why streaming apps fail. You need a solid internet connection for your Roku to pull the Fox61 News stream. So, how do you check if your internet is playing nice? It’s pretty easy.
Test Other Apps: Try opening a different streaming app on your Roku, like Netflix, Hulu, or even YouTube. If those apps are also struggling to load or are buffering like crazy, then the problem is almost certainly with your internet service. If other apps are working fine, then we can narrow down the issue to the Fox61 News app or Roku specifically.
Check Your Wi-Fi Signal: Take a look at the Wi-Fi signal strength indicator on your Roku. You can usually find this in the Network Settings. If the signal is weak (only one or two bars), it might not be strong enough to reliably stream video content. Try moving your Roku closer to your Wi-Fi router if possible, or consider a Wi-Fi extender if you have a larger home.
Restart Your Router and Modem: This is the IT crowd's secret weapon, and it works wonders! Unplug both your modem and your Wi-Fi router from the power outlet. Wait for about 30-60 seconds. Then, plug the modem back in first and wait for it to fully power up and connect (usually indicated by stable lights). After that, plug your Wi-Fi router back in and wait for it to power up completely. Once everything is back online, try launching the Fox61 News app again. This simple power cycle often resolves temporary network glitches that can plague your connection.
Check Your Internet Speed: You can do this on a computer or phone connected to the same network. Go to a speed test website (like Speedtest.net). Most streaming services recommend a minimum download speed of around 3-5 Mbps for standard HD streaming. If your speeds are significantly lower, you might need to contact your internet service provider (ISP) to inquire about potential issues or upgrade your plan.
By systematically checking these points, you can usually pinpoint whether your internet connection is the reason Fox61 News isn't streaming. If everything else checks out and other apps are working fine, then we'll move on to the next set of solutions. Don't give up yet!
